초록

Advanced sensor-system-integrated injection molding is a promising technology that can overcome long-lasting problems in the injection molding industry, improve product quality, increase productivity, and reduce total losses. Particularly, advanced sensor systems used in injection molding enable a leap forward in injection molding by implementing novel technologies such as in-situ process monitoring, in-line quality monitoring, and process optimization. In this review, state-of-the-art sensor utilization and applications in the injection molding industry are discussed, ranging from additional sensors utilized in sensor-integrated injection molding machines to advanced sensor applications incorporating artificial intelligence in the injection molding industry in the future. The requirements and challenges of advanced sensor systems in the injection molding industry are also highlighted while providing perspectives for future development.
